Former Purdue Footballer Gets Prison Time

(WEST LAFAYETTE) - A former Purdue University football player has received a 37-year prison sentence for beating up two women on campus.

21-year-old Kyle Williams was convicted of attempted rape, battery and confinement in connection with the attacks, which occurred 90 minutes apart on November 29th, 2005.

Williams had been released from his scholarship at Purdue days before the attacks.
